Winter riding presents unique challenges for eBikes: cold temperatures reduce battery performance [1], road salt corrodes components, and wet conditions accelerate wear. Proper winterization protects your investment, maintains performance, and ensures safe riding through the coldest months. This comprehensive guide covers everything from battery care to component protection, helping you ride confidently all winter long.

Why Winterization Matters

Battery performance [1]: Cold temperatures reduce battery capacity [1] by 20-40%. A battery providing 40 miles in summer might only deliver 25-30 miles at 20°F.

Corrosion: Road salt is highly corrosive to aluminum, steel, and electrical connections. Unprotected bikes can develop serious corrosion in a single winter.

Component wear: Wet, gritty conditions accelerate drivetrain wear by 2-3x. Chains, cassettes, and chainrings wear faster without proper protection.

Safety: Cold weather affects tire grip, brake performance, and visibility. Proper preparation keeps you safe.

Resale value: A well-maintained bike that's been protected from winter damage retains significantly more value.

Battery Care (Most Critical)

Understanding Cold Weather Battery Behavior

Lithium-ion batteries (used in all modern eBikes) experience reduced performance in cold:

  • 40°F: 10-15% capacity reduction
  • 32°F: 20-25% capacity reduction
  • 20°F: 30-40% capacity reduction
  • 0°F: 40-50% capacity reduction

The battery isn't damaged—it's a temporary chemical reaction. Capacity returns when the battery warms up.

Winter Battery Best Practices

Store battery indoors: Remove battery after rides and store at room temperature (60-70°F). This is the single most important winterization step.

Charge indoors: Never charge a cold battery. Bring it inside, let it warm to room temperature (wait 1-2 hours), then charge.

Pre-warm before riding: Install battery just before riding. A warm battery performs much better than one that's been sitting in a cold garage.

Keep battery insulated during rides: Use a neoprene battery cover ($20-30) to retain heat generated during use.

Maintain 60-80% charge: If not riding for weeks, store battery at 60-80% charge, not full or empty.

Check charge monthly: Even stored batteries self-discharge. Check monthly and recharge if below 40%.

Battery Covers and Insulation

Neoprene battery covers ($25-35) - Wrap around battery, retain heat, protect from road spray.

DIY option: Wrap battery in bubble wrap or foam, secure with velcro straps. Not as elegant but effective.

Heated battery bags ($50-80) - Active heating for extreme cold. Overkill for most riders but useful below 0°F.

Frame and Component Protection

Anti-Corrosion Treatment

Road salt causes serious corrosion if left unchecked. Protect your frame and components:

Frame protection film ($30-50) - Clear adhesive film protects paint from salt and scratches. Apply to:

  • Downtube (maximum salt exposure)
  • Chainstays
  • Seat stays
  • Any area prone to cable rub

Frame wax or sealant ($15-25) - Apply automotive wax or bike-specific frame sealant to entire frame. Creates barrier against moisture and salt.

Application: Clean frame thoroughly, apply wax/sealant, buff to shine. Reapply monthly during winter.

Recommended products:

  • Muc-Off Bike Protect ($15) - Spray-on protection, easy application
  • Pedro's Bike Lust ($12) - Polish and protectant in one
  • Automotive paste wax ($10) - Traditional but effective

Electrical Connection Protection

Dielectric grease ($8-12) - Apply to all electrical connections:

  • Battery contacts
  • Motor connections
  • Display connections
  • Light connections

How to apply:

  1. Disconnect connection
  2. Clean contacts with electrical contact cleaner
  3. Apply thin layer of dielectric grease to both sides
  4. Reconnect

Frequency: Apply at start of winter, reapply mid-winter if riding frequently.

Bolt and Fastener Protection

Anti-seize compound ($10-15) - Apply to bolt threads to prevent corrosion and seizing.

Focus areas:

  • Seat post clamp
  • Stem bolts
  • Rack mounting bolts
  • Fender mounting bolts

Application: Remove bolt, clean threads, apply thin layer of anti-seize, reinstall.

Drivetrain Winterization

Switch to Wet Lube

Why: Wet lube resists water washout better than dry lube. Essential for winter riding.

Recommended products:

  • Finish Line Wet ($10)
  • Boeshield T-9 ($15)
  • White Lightning Epic Ride ($12)

Application frequency: Every 50-100 miles (more often than summer) due to wet conditions washing away lube.

Increase Cleaning Frequency

Weekly cleaning: Remove salt and grit before it causes damage.

Quick winter clean:

  1. Spray drivetrain with degreaser
  2. Scrub with brush
  3. Rinse with water
  4. Dry completely
  5. Apply wet lube liberally

Time required: 15 minutes

Consider a Winter Chain

Option: Install a new chain at start of winter, remove and store your good chain.

Why: Winter conditions accelerate chain wear. A sacrificial winter chain protects your cassette and chainrings.

Cost: $25-35 for decent chain

Benefit: Your primary chain lasts 2-3x longer, cassette and chainring wear is reduced.

Tire Considerations

Tire Pressure Adjustment

Lower pressure for winter: Reduce pressure by 5-10 PSI for better traction on slippery surfaces.

Example:

  • Summer: 45 PSI
  • Winter: 38-40 PSI

Benefit: Larger contact patch improves grip on wet, icy, or snowy surfaces.

Tire Choice

Standard conditions (wet, cold, occasional snow): Puncture-resistant tires with good tread pattern

  • Schwalbe Marathon Plus
  • Continental Contact Plus

Frequent snow/ice: Studded tires provide dramatically better traction

  • Schwalbe Marathon Winter ($80-100 each)
  • 45NRTH Gravdal ($90-110 each)

Studded tire benefits:

  • 10x better traction on ice
  • Confidence-inspiring grip
  • Shorter stopping distances

Studded tire drawbacks:

  • Expensive ($160-220/pair)
  • Heavier (adds 1-2 lbs per wheel)
  • Slower on dry pavement
  • Noisy on bare pavement

When to use studs: If you regularly encounter ice or hard-packed snow, studs are worth the investment. For occasional snow, standard tires with lower pressure work adequately.

Brake Maintenance

Brake Pad Inspection

Winter conditions wear brake pads faster. Inspect monthly and replace when less than 1mm of pad material remains.

Rotor Cleaning

Road spray and salt contaminate brake rotors, reducing braking power.

Weekly cleaning:

  1. Spray rotors with isopropyl alcohol
  2. Wipe with clean rag
  3. Test brakes before riding

Hydraulic Brake Fluid

Cold temperatures can affect brake fluid performance.

Check fluid level: Ensure reservoir is full. Low fluid reduces braking power.

Bleed if spongy: If brakes feel spongy in cold weather, they may need bleeding. Consider professional service ($40-60).

Lighting and Visibility

Light Check

Days are shorter in winter—you'll ride in darkness more often.

Verify:

  • Front light: 500+ lumens minimum
  • Rear light: Bright flash mode
  • Batteries fully charged
  • Mounts secure

Upgrade if needed: Winter is when lights matter most. Invest in quality lighting if your current setup is marginal.

Visibility Enhancements

Reflective tape ($10-15) - Add to frame, fenders, panniers for 360° visibility.

Reflective vest ($20-30) - Wear over winter jacket for maximum visibility.

Wheel lights ($15-25) - LED lights on spokes create visible circle. Fun and functional.

Storage Solutions

Daily Storage (If Riding Regularly)

Garage/shed storage:

  • Remove battery, bring indoors
  • Cover bike with tarp or bike cover to protect from moisture
  • Elevate bike slightly to prevent tires from freezing to floor

Indoor storage:

  • Ideal for battery and bike
  • Use mat or tray under bike to catch drips and protect floor
  • Wipe down bike after wet rides to prevent indoor corrosion

Long-Term Storage (If Not Riding)

Preparation:

  1. Clean bike thoroughly
  2. Lubricate chain heavily
  3. Inflate tires to maximum pressure
  4. Remove battery, store at 60% charge indoors
  5. Cover bike completely

Monthly maintenance during storage:

  • Check battery charge, recharge if below 40%
  • Rotate wheels to prevent flat spots on tires
  • Check for any moisture or corrosion

Post-Ride Maintenance

After Every Winter Ride

5-minute routine:

  1. Wipe down frame with damp cloth to remove salt
  2. Wipe down chain
  3. Remove battery, bring indoors
  4. Check brakes for contamination
  5. Hang bike to dry if wet

Time investment: 5 minutes after each ride prevents hours of corrosion repair later.

Weekly Deep Clean

15-minute routine:

  1. Wash bike with mild soap and water
  2. Clean drivetrain with degreaser
  3. Dry completely
  4. Apply fresh lube to chain
  5. Check all bolts for tightness
  6. Inspect for any corrosion starting

Spring De-Winterization

End-of-Winter Inspection

When winter ends, perform thorough inspection:

Check for corrosion:

  • Frame (especially welds and joints)
  • Bolts and fasteners
  • Electrical connections
  • Brake and derailleur cables

Address immediately: Small corrosion spots become big problems if ignored.

Component wear check:

  • Chain wear (replace if stretched)
  • Brake pad thickness
  • Tire condition
  • Cable condition

One thing I'd add from my experience here in Portland is the critical importance of checking your brake caliper bolts and rotor bolts frequently; the road grit and salt spray here loves to seize those tiny fasteners up, and a quick drop of medium threadlocker (blue) on reassembly can save a massive headache come spring.
